Wondering if it's a bad relay switch...?

found a tx-v940 at goodwill. same problem - no power to speakers. Did randomly come on at times, but when powered off then on again, there's nothing at the speakers again. Also a series of clicking noises, like some component is powering on/off. Wondering if it's a bad relay switch....?

Receivers usually use relays to provide speaker protection in the case of a fault on the output of a channel (also used to prevent the speakers from catching fire if due to a fault there was excessive current flow to the speaker). it sounds like one or more are operating.

Here is a link to the service manual for a Onkyo TX-V940. It has all the information, e.g. circuit diagrams etc, to help you to find the problem.
